This procedure isn’t the preferred treatment method since it’s still experimental. If the lasers are aimed incorrectly, you could risk damage to your retina. This can cause them to break up and may reduce their presence. Laser therapy involves aiming lasers at the eye floaters. This surgery is used for severe symptoms of floaters. It’s still possible for them to form again, specifically if this procedure causes any bleeding or trauma. Though effective, a vitrectomy may not always remove eye floaters. Your body will then produce more vitreous that will eventually replace this new solution. Your doctor will replace the vitreous with a solution to maintain the shape of your eye. The vitreous is a clear, gel-like substance that keeps the shape of your eye round. Within this procedure, your eye doctor will remove the vitreous through a small incision. VitrectomyĪ vitrectomy is an invasive surgery that can remove eye floaters from your line of vision. But if you find anything to be excessive, reach out to your healthcare provider. Most Paxlovid side effects are mild and should go away on their own. When should I contact my healthcare provider about Paxlovid side effects? Make sure your healthcare provider knows if you have a history of liver issues before you start taking it. But because of what experts know about ritonavir, Paxlovid is not recommended for people with severe liver problems. Liver damage wasn’t reported in Paxlovid’s clinical trials. This side effect is more likely to happen in people who already have liver problems. Ritonavir is known to contribute to liver damage. Liver damageĪs mentioned earlier, Paxlovid contains the medication ritonavir. Acetaminophen (Tylenol) and 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in) are two options that don’t interact with Paxlovid. But if you find them bothersome, over-the-counter pain relievers may help. But it’s relatively rare with the medication. Paxlovid may cause headaches for some people who take it. Headaches are no fun and can make it difficult to complete your usual activities. Let them know if your blood pressure is still high after finishing the medication. But your healthcare provider may ask you to check your blood pressure at home while taking it. Your blood pressure should return to normal after finishing Paxlovid. Small numbers of people who took Paxlovid have reported this side effect. And this can be a concern if you already have high blood pressure or other heart conditions. It’s not unusual for a medication to raise blood pressure. Show coupon to your pharmacist Present your printed or electronic coupon when you pick up your prescription. If your diarrhea doesn’t clear up after finishing Paxlovid, reach out to your healthcare provider.ģ. You may also find a bland diet sits better with you. Be sure to drink plenty of fluids and watch for symptoms of dehydration. A similar number of people taking a placebo (a pill with no medication in it) also reported it.ĭiarrhea with Paxlovid can typically be managed at home. But keep in mind, diarrhea is also a symptom of COVID. #Known after effects of covid 19 trial#About 3% of clinical trial participants reported this side effect. While uncommon, loose stools are possible with Paxlovid. Diarrheaĭiarrhea is a common side effect of many medications. If these taste changes are causing you to throw up, contact your healthcare provider. In the meantime, sucking on mints or strongly flavored candies may be helpful. It should go away once you stop treatment with Paxlovid, which usually only lasts 5 days. Thankfully, this side effect is temporary and relatively mild for many. But even though it’s typical, that doesn’t mean it’s pleasant. It’s also a common side effect of ritonavir (Norvir) - one of the two antivirals in Paxlovid. In fact, it was the most commonly reported side effect during clinical trials. These taste changes were expected when Paxlovid was initially FDA authorized in 2021. But they all agree on one thing - it’s gross. Those who experience it describe it in different ways, a couple being a bitter or metallic taste. This experience was coined “ Paxlovid mouth” by many news outlets. As Paxlovid became more widely available, many people began reporting taste changes as a side effect. But this side effect is different from that. Loss of smell or taste is a well-known symptom of COVID. #Known after effects of covid 19 how to#Let’s take a look at five Paxlovid side effects and how to manage them. While some are common, others are more unique. It’s considered the first-choice option for treating mild to moderate COVID in this group of people.īut as with all medications, Paxlovid has some side effects. This antiviral medication is FDA approved for adults at high risk of developing severe illness from COVID. Paxlovid (nirmatrelvir / ritonavir) has been a life-saver for many people with COVID-19.

Not to mention, the CDC says these are the most effective on market for “trapping particles that people exhale when breathing, talking, singing, coughing, and sneezing.” What Are the Best Purifiers for Covid? These filters can capture at least 99.97 percent of particles as small as 0.3 microns, which includes most airborne pathogens. No two air purifiers are the same, but one of the most important things to look for in the best air purifiers for viruses is the inclusion of a high-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filter. So overall, don’t think of air purifiers as an all-in-one solution or quick fix. The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) also cautions that “by itself, air cleaning or filtration is not enough to protect people from exposure to the virus that causes COVID-19.” But, they say that regular air filtration can be part of your household’s overall plan to reduce “reduce the potential for airborne transmission of COVID-19 indoors.” This has the added advantage of really giving your household air a good cleaning during general flu and allergy season. While currently, there haven’t been any air purifiers tested directly against the Covid-19 virus, most top-rated air purifiers will have efficient filters capable of capturing those pesky, tiny airborne particles similar to those that cause coronavirus.
